Trex Inc. (TREX)
NYSE: TREX
· Real-Time Price · USD
50.71
0.23 (0.46%)
At close: Sep 26, 2025, 1:11 PM
Trex Revenue
Trex reported an annual revenue of $1.15B, reflecting a 5.17% growth. For the quarter ending June 30, 2025, Trex generated $387.8M in revenue.
Revenue (ttm)
1.15B
Revenue Growth
5.17%
Price / Sales Ratio
6.49
Revenue / Employee
626.47K
Employees
1,838
Market Cap
5.44B
Revenue Chart
History
Fiscal Year End | Revenue | % Change |
---|---|---|
Dec 31, 2024 | 1.15B | +5.17% |
Dec 31, 2023 | 1.09B | -1.01% |
Dec 31, 2022 | 1.11B | -7.60% |
Dec 31, 2021 | 1.2B | +35.89% |
Dec 31, 2020 | 880.83M | +18.18% |
Dec 31, 2019 | 745.35M | +8.93% |
Dec 31, 2018 | 684.25M | +21.07% |
Dec 31, 2017 | 565.15M | +17.83% |
Dec 31, 2016 | 479.62M | +8.80% |
Dec 31, 2015 | 440.8M | +12.55% |
Dec 31, 2014 | 391.66M | +14.35% |
Dec 31, 2013 | 342.51M | +11.44% |
Dec 31, 2012 | 307.35M | +15.20% |
Dec 31, 2011 | 266.79M | -16.02% |
Dec 31, 2010 | 317.69M | +16.68% |
Dec 31, 2009 | 272.29M | -17.29% |
Dec 31, 2008 | 329.19M | +0.07% |
Dec 31, 2007 | 328.95M | -2.38% |
Dec 31, 2006 | 336.96M | +14.56% |
Dec 31, 2005 | 294.13M | +15.97% |
Dec 31, 2004 | 253.63M | +32.78% |
Dec 31, 2003 | 191.01M | +14.32% |
Dec 31, 2002 | 167.08M | +42.97% |
Dec 31, 2001 | 116.86M | -0.60% |
Dec 31, 2000 | 117.57M | +58.23% |
Dec 31, 1999 | 74.3M | +58.76% |
Dec 31, 1998 | 46.8M | +37.24% |
Dec 31, 1997 | 34.1M | +498.25% |
Dec 31, 1996 | 5.7M | n/a |